Use the ruler to measure the length of Line segment R S to the nearest centimeter.

Answer:

Length of the line segment RS is, 18 cm.

Step-by-step explanation:

Two points are drawn on a ruler. Point R is located at 8 cm and Point S is located at 26 cm.

So, length of the line segment RS is,

(26 - 8) cm\

= 18 cm

We know that on a ruler if two points A and B are at a cm and b cm respectively, then, length of AB

= AB = \mid b - a \mid cm .

The diameter of a circle is 3.2 meters. Which is the circumference of the circle rounded to the nearest hundredth of a meter?
Paraphin [41]

Answer:

10.05 meters

Step-by-step explanation:

If the diameter is 3.2 meters, then the radius is 1.6 meters.

Use the circumference formula, C = 2\pir, and solve for C

C = 2\pir

C = 2\pi(1.6)

C = 3.2\pi

C = 10.05

So, to the nearest hundredth of a meter, the circumference is 10.05 meters
